Welcome to on-call for GraphGrove! The dependency graph visualizer mostly runs itself, but the nightly render job occasionally chokes on cyclic edges — just requeue it. Dashboards live under the Pinehollow tenant. If you need to push a hotfix, deploys go through the usual pipeline, and the artifact must be signed. Use the on-call deploy key below.

release key, tahag-kajog: bky13_5hREwd9SXkveP

Leadership Review Briefing — Varento Works Capacity Decision

Department heads are asked to review the proposal to expand the Kelsmoor plant's third line rather than commission a new site at Drayfell. Tooling lead times, labour availability, and projected demand for the Orvex series all favour expansion, though ventilation upgrades add cost. A full risk annex follows separately. The strategic rationale is summarised in the note below.

internal memo for hahif-hahaf: Headcount on the Zorwyn team goes from 9 to 100 by the end of October. Gross margin on Zorwyn came in at 5 percent against a plan of 10 percent.

### Vendor Note: The Orphan Sweeper (Tidewrack)

Quick intro for you: Tidewrack is our orphaned-resource sweeper. It runs nightly and deletes cloud resources — volumes, snapshots, stray load balancers — that have no owner tag and no activity for 14 days. Anything you spin up for vendor testing needs an owner tag, or it will quietly vanish. Don't panic if something disappears; there's a 7-day soft-delete window and we can restore it. To request a restore or an exemption tag, write to the sweeper team at the address below.

pager mailbox: druwyn@norvaio.corp

Changelog — week of the Marchetto release. Heads up for eng sync: we renamed AUTOSCALE_KEY to QDEPTH_SCALER_TOKEN in the Fennelworks queue-depth autoscaler. The old name was confusingly shared with the billing scaler and at least two on-call pages traced back to people editing the wrong one. Behavior is identical, just the new name; the deploy script warns if it sees the old key but won't migrate it for you. Update your env files so they contain the line below.

vault entry, yahif-yajep: COURIER_KEY29=b802bdf8034096b65a51c6ba5abe2